WebFootfall is defined as the number of people, or traffic, entering a store, and is an important indicator of how successful a company’s marketing is at bringing customers into stores. …
WebNational retail footfall. National retail footfall figures are supplied by Springboard, a provider of data on customer activity. The breakdowns in this indicator are as follows: overall footfall, which is the sum of the average footfall in each destination type weighted by their respective footfall volumes

Some dictionaries say that Americans use foot traffic while the UK and Ireland use footfall. However, I have seen many American publications use footfall, especially over the last ten years.
